New skin cream takes on classic jelly in dryness battle
NCT ID NCT07183423
Summary
This study is testing a new skin cream to see if it helps with dry, itchy skin conditions like eczema and psoriasis. Researchers will compare it to petroleum jelly, a common moisturizer. About 26 adults will apply one of the creams twice a day for four weeks and have their skin checked regularly.
